The nuclear radius of a certain nucleus is 7.2 fm and it has a charge of 1.28×10⁻¹⁷ C. The number of neutrons inside the nucleus is
Options
(a) 136
(b) 142
(c) 140
(d) 132
Correct Answer:
136
